What is the sum of the exterior angles of a convex polygon with N sides?

Conjecture (Exterior Angle Conjecture ): The sum of the n exterior angles for any convex polygon with n sides is 360 degrees.

What is the formula for finding the sum of the angles of any convex polygon?

Theorem 39: If a convex polygon has n sides, then its interior angle sum is given by the following equation: S = ( n −2) × 180°. Theorem 40: If a polygon is convex, then the sum of the degree measures of the exterior angles, one at each vertex, is 360°.

What is the measure of one exterior angle of a regular pentagon?

Answer: The measure of each exterior angle of a regular pentagon is 72° A regular pentagon has all angles of the same measure and all sides of the same length.

What is the sum of the interior angles of a 18 sided polygon?

The sum of the measures of the interior angle of any polygon is the number of sides minus 2 multiplied by 180. A polygon with 18 sides has an interior angle sum of 2880 degrees.
